Design Philosophy
The Y300 embraces a clean, contemporary design language that feels cohesive with Vivo’s broader aestheti.
With a thickness of approximately 8.4mm and weighing around 188 grams, the device strikes a comfortable balance between substantial feel and everyday portability.
The plastic frame and back panel feature a subtle texture that resists fingerprints while providing secure grip during use.
Available in two attractive colorways – Ocean Blue and Midnight Black – the device offers options that appeal to different tastes without adding significant production complexity.
The camera module sits in the upper left corner of the back panel, housing the dual-lens system in a rectangular arrangement that integrates well with the overall design.
The front display features reasonably slim bezels with a waterdrop notch for the selfie camera, creating a modern appearance that maximizes screen real estate.
While not utilizing premium materials throughout, the overall construction feels durable and well-assembled, conveying quality beyond its price point.
Display Experience
The front of the device showcases a 6.56-inch IPS LCD display with HD+ resolution (1612 × 720 pixels).
While not matching the visual impact of higher-resolution panels or AMOLED technology, the screen delivers acceptable performance for its category with reasonable color reproduction and adequate viewing angles for personal use.
The 90Hz refresh rate provides smoother scrolling and animations throughout the user interface compared to standard 60Hz displays still common in this price segment.
The screen achieves a peak brightness of approximately 480 nits, ensuring adequate visibility in most indoor environments though it may struggle under direct sunlight.
Vivo has incorporated useful display features including Eye Protection mode to reduce blue light emission during extended usage.
The display is protected by Panda Glass, providing basic resistance against everyday scratches and minor impacts.
Performance Profile
Under the hood, the Y300 is pow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 4 Gen 1 chipset, an octa-core processor featuring two Cortex-A78 performance cores clocked at 2.0GHz and six Cortex-A55 efficiency cores running at 1.8GHz.
Built on a 6nm manufacturing process, this entry-level SoC balances performance with power efficiency for everyday tasks.
The device comes in configurations with either 4GB or 6GB of LPDDR4X RAM paired with 64GB or 128GB of eMMC 5.1 storage, expandable via microSD card up to 1TB.
Vivo’s Extended RAM feature can virtually allocate up to 6GB of additional memory from storage when needed, helping maintain performance during moderate multitasking.
Day-to-day performance feels responsive for common tasks like social media browsing, messaging, and media playback.
The Adreno 619 GPU handles casual gaming competently, though more graphically intense titles require reduced settings to maintain playable frame rates.
For its intended audience of budget-conscious users with modest performance requirements, the Y300 delivers a satisfying experience.
Camera Capabilities
Photography on the Y300 is handled by a dual-camera system consisting of a 50MP primary sensor with f/1.8 aperture and a 2MP depth sensor for portrait effects.
This straightforward camera setup reflects the device’s budget positioning while still providing decent imaging capabilities for everyday moments.
The main camera captures good photos in well-lit environments, with Vivo’s image processing delivering pleasing colors and acceptable dynamic range for its class.
The dedicated depth sensor helps create reasonably convincing background blur in portrait shots, though edge detection occasionally struggles with complex subjects.
The front-facing 8MP selfie camera performs adequately for video calls and casual self-portraits, with software-based beauty modes available for those who prefer enhanced facial features.
Video recording capabilities max out at 1080p/30fps, delivering functional if unremarkable results suitable for social media sharing.
Vivo’s camera app includes useful features like Super Night mode for improved low-light photography, Portrait mode with adjustable background blur, and various filters for creative expression.
While not competing with mid-range camera systems, the Y300’s imaging capabilities meet the essential needs of its target audience.
Battery Life and Charging
Battery endurance stands out as one of the Y300’s strengths, featuring a 5,000mAh cell that easily handles a full day of typical usage.
Screen-on time typically ranges between 7-8 hours with mixed usage including social media browsing, video streaming, and casual gaming.
When it’s time to recharge, the included 15W fast charger replenishes the battery from empty to full in approximately 2.5 hours.
While not particularly fast by current standards, this charging speed proves adequate given the generous battery capacity and entry-level positioning.
Vivo has implemented several battery optimization features through FuntouchOS, including Ultra Game Mode that balances performance and battery life during gaming sessions and background app management that intelligently restricts power-hungry applications.
Software Experience
The Y300 runs Vivo’s FuntouchOS 14 based on Android 14, offering a feature-rich interface with extensive customization options.
Vivo has committed to two years of security updates, providing basic longevity for a device in this price segment.
The software experience includes useful features like Ultra Game Mode for optimizing gaming performance, Dynamic Effects for customizable animations, and Multi-Turbo for system optimization.
While some pre-installed applications are present, most can be uninstalled or disabled according to user preference.
